About Bakken Museum
The Bakken Museum is a fascinating destination for families looking to spark curiosity and inspire innovation in their children. Nestled on the picturesque west shore of Bde Maka Ska in Minneapolis, this museum provides a unique blend of science, technology, and the humanities. With a rich collection of artifacts and engaging educational programs, the Bakken Museum explores the wonders of invention, plant medicine, and technology.
Kids will be captivated by interactive exhibits that allow them to delve into the world of scientific discovery. The museum also features the serene Florence Bakken Medicinal Garden, where families can learn about the historical and modern uses of plants in medicine. It's a perfect place for a peaceful stroll and for children to learn the importance of our natural world.
The Bakken Museum is not just about learning; it’s about making memories. With family-friendly activities and special events, there is always something exciting happening. From hands-on workshops to seasonal celebrations, the museum offers a variety of experiences that cater to all ages. Suggest editHow much does it cost?
Suggest editAdults Adults: $11 Seniors (62+): $9 Students (with ID): $8
Children Children (4-17): $6 Children (3 and under): Free Limited Income Admission: $1
Free Under 3 years
